What I Looked for in the Material
The first thing I checked was the type of wood. I found that solid wood usually feels more durable and long-lasting, while engineered wood can be more affordable and still look attractive. I paid attention to the finish too, because I wanted something that matched my room and could handle everyday use without showing wear too quickly.
Why Glass Door Quality Mattered to Me
The glass doors were a big part of my decision. I looked for tempered glass because it feels safer and more durable. I also checked whether the doors closed smoothly and had strong hinges. For me, clear glass worked best because it showed off my books and decor, but frosted glass would be a good choice if someone wants a more private or softer look.
Size and Storage Capacity I Considered
Before buying, I measured the wall space carefully. I learned that the right height and width matter just as much as style. I also thought about shelf depth and how many books I actually needed to store. Adjustable shelves were especially useful for me because they let me fit tall books, framed photos, and decorative items more easily.
Style and Design That Fit My Space
I wanted the bookcase to blend with my existing furniture, so I looked at the overall design. Some bookcases felt traditional with detailed woodwork, while others looked more modern and simple. I found that the glass doors made the piece feel lighter visually, which helped in smaller rooms. The finish color also played a big role in how well it matched my home.
What I Checked for Durability
I paid attention to the frame, shelves, and door hardware. A strong frame and well-supported shelves gave me confidence that the bookcase could hold heavy items. I also checked weight limits, because I didn’t want shelves sagging over time. Good-quality hinges and handles made the whole piece feel more reliable.
Assembly and Maintenance I Kept in Mind
I considered how easy it would be to assemble before I bought it. Some bookcases come mostly assembled, while others need more setup time. I also thought about maintenance. A wood finish that wipes clean easily and glass doors that don’t show fingerprints too badly made my life simpler. I found that regular dusting and occasional glass cleaning keep the bookcase looking great.
Safety Features I Didn’t Ignore
If the bookcase is tall, I always recommend checking for wall anchoring options. That gave me peace of mind, especially in a busy home. I also looked for smooth door edges and sturdy construction so the piece would be safer to use every day. For homes with children, I think secure doors and anti-tip hardware are especially important.
